Any first time visitor to the Federal Capital Territory (FCT), Abuja, especially from other parts of Nigeria or other African countries, will be captivated by the spectacle of this only planned city in the country. It is a city that, like bees to nectar, attracts all manner of people. While some leave different parts of the country to find the proverbial green grasses in Abuja, others, especially those who are tired with the chaos and bustle of Lagos, for instance, come to Abuja to find peace. Its fantastically well laid roads and other infrastructure give a feeling that what many Nigerians see on television and foreign movies as what a planned city should look like can actually be found in Nigeria.
